The problems linked to sinking slabs usually involve uneven surfaces that create tripping hazards, water pooling, or further deterioration of the concrete. These issues can impact the safety of walkways and driveways, making everyday activities more difficult or even dangerous. Additionally, sinking slabs can diminish curb appeal and property value, prompting homeowners to seek effective repair solutions. When searching for signs you need concrete mudjacking for sinking slabs, many are trying to determine whether their concrete issues are caused by soil settlement, erosion, or poor compaction. Understanding these underlying causes helps homeowners decide if mudjacking is a practical fix to lift and level the affected concrete.

Understanding the signs that indicate the need for concrete mudjacking can help homeowners and property managers take timely action to address sinking slabs. Common indicators include visible cracks, uneven surfaces, and noticeable height differences between sections of concrete. Other signs might be water pooling or drainage problems caused by uneven slabs, or the appearance of new cracks after extreme weather events. Recognizing these issues early allows for a more straightforward repair process and helps maintain the safety and appearance of the property. What are common signs that indicate sinking slabs may need mudjacking? Visible cracks, uneven surfaces, or tilting slabs are typical indicators that local contractors might recommend mudjacking to restore stability.

How can I tell if my concrete slab has shifted or sunk? If the slab appears uneven, has settled lower than surrounding areas, or if doors and windows no longer close properly, it may require assessment by local service providers.

Are there specific signs that suggest my concrete needs leveling? Yes, noticeable cracks, pooling water, or a visibly uneven surface can signal that local contractors should evaluate whether mudjacking is appropriate.

What issues might arise from sinking concrete slabs? Sinking slabs can cause trip hazards, damage to structures, and water drainage problems, which local pros can address through mudjacking solutions.
